Output 70188e72c7158b5cf0a8e89d10ce5b00d4f77e99586a89370a31d5ae3a392d04:2

value
2600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 854b65425359b99c03848ee78347d8ae97469ad5 OP_EQUAL
address
3Dqp7daEiDKcyYVvrZvMNS6WuoqR5w2tkL
transaction
70188e72c7158b5cf0a8e89d10ce5b00d4f77e99586a89370a31d5ae3a392d04
spent
true